Five Signs You Need To Have Heating System Repair Service in Dallas County
These are some of the most regular service calls we get for heating system repair. Dealing with these troubles in your house? Give us a call today, and we will be out right away to find a solution.
Heater would not begin. In many cases this is a result of a wrong thermostat setting. It may likewise recommend something various is incorrect, and a safety feature is stopping your heating system from turning on.
Energy expenses are increasing. Every occasionally your heating unit has concerns with producing enough heat. Which needs it to work harder to warm your home, indicating more expensive HVAC expenses.
Heater starts off and stops frequently. A furnace that is functioning smoothly should not be turning on and off sometimes throughout the day. This is believed to be short biking, and it might affect your energy bills and the life expectancy of your heating system.
Hot and cold areas throughout your home. A malfunctioning heater and duct system generally would not efficiently disperse the heated and cooled air where it is required. Your heating and cooling should continually be uniformly spread through your home.
Extreme or unusual sounds. If your heating system is producing unusual noises, like banging, screeching or rattling, it needs service instantly, give us a call as fast as possible for a service visit.

Why Do I Need a Nice and Tidy Heating System Filter in Irving?
When your furnace filtering system gets unclean, dirty and blocked, you can picture some negative impacts on your heater performance and your indoor air quality. The forced air is expected to have blown through the filter and the filter is planned to trap any dust so they do not wind up in your air ducts and throughout your home. When the purification system has caught a lot of pollutants and it is congested, the air keeps blowing, however some of those caught dust will wind up in the system and your living location. Another repercussion is that the heater has to work more difficult to get the exact same quantity of air through that dirty filter, so your heating bills may increase.

Cutting Heating Expenses
Correct heater care and clever purchases can assist you reduce the high costs of heating your home. That's great news thinking about that energy bills-which are currently historically high-are expected to continue to climb. A current article in USA Today reported that property owners on average will see a 25.7 percent increase in heating costs compared to a year ago.
To reduce heating costs, specialists say that the energy performance of your heating system is extremely important. According to Jim Miller of Amana brand name heaters, "Homeowners do not have much control over the price of gas, but they can take steps to lessen the effect of home heating expenses." He offers these suggestions:
"If you haven't currently done so this year, have a certified HVAC contractor examine your heating system now," Miller stressed. "He can carry out a safety assessment and tidy your furnace so that it runs as efficiently as possible."
A heater's effectiveness is suggested by its Annual Fuel Utilization Efficiency portion, or "AFUE," a measurement established by the U.S. Department of Energy. The higher a heating system's AFUE, the more effective it is. "Furnaces older than 15 years run at performances of approximately 60% AFUE.
"If you were to replace that 60% AFUE heater with a high-efficiency unit, such as the Amana brand name AMV9 96% AFUE Variable-Speed Furnace, you would get 96 cents worth of warmth for every dollar you spend toward heating your home," said Miller.
Since the blowers usually need up to 75 percent less electrical power than a basic motor, he included that heating systems with a variable-speed blower are even more effective. In addition, a heating system's blower likewise deals with the house's cooling system, meaning consumers experience increased performance year-round.
Thanks to the Energy Policy Act of 2005 (EPACT), homeowners who buy heaters with an AFUE of 95% or higher in 2006 and 2007 might certify for a tax credit of $150. And if that heating system uses a variable-speed blower, they may qualify for an additional $50 tax credit.
